The Finger Lakes region of New York State is an appealing place to live for people seeking a balance of natural beauty, affordability, and quality of life. Stretching across scenic areas like Finger Lakes , this region is known for its eleven long, narrow lakes, rolling hills, and vibrant small towns. One of the biggest draws is the landscape. Residents enjoy easy access to outdoor activities year-round—boating, hiking, fishing, and skiing are all within reach. Parks such as Watkins Glen State Park and Letchworth State Park offer dramatic waterfalls, gorges, and trails that rival some of the most famous natural attractions in the country.

Job Description:

Under the supervision of a physician, applies principles, methods and procedures for managing athletic injuries, which shall include preconditioning, conditioning and reconditioning of an individual who has suffered an athletic injury through the use of appropriate preventative and supportive devices. Provides instruction to coaches, athletes, parents, medical personnel and communication in the area of care and prevention of athletic injuries. The individual will work in school systems and in a physician or hospital clinic to support patient care. The Athletic Trainer will provide coverage to sporting events as agreed upon by the Health System contract and based upon the schedule that is prepared by the hiring organization.
